The "M16A2" is clearly an A1-styled carbine, most likely an XM177 or XM177E1 by the length of the barrel, and the MP5 looks more like an old style MP5A2 ("S-E-F" trigger group instead of bullet pictograms) with slimline handguard and an add-on suppressor than an SD. AK-47

Apart from SVD with PSL mag the AK-47 in this game looks more like Type-56 mixed with Zastava M70B1 receiver and handguards. This page may need some remake (see mis-identified AR-style carbine or MP5 variant), I'm thinking about doing it soon. --Chris22lr (talk) 08:18, 22 January 2014 (EST)

I was gonna propose to change the section to a Zastava M70B1 due to the handguard and RPK-style receiver. Should we list it as such? (or is it some kind of hybrid like Chris said?) Also, here's extra shots of the weapon:

The (horrible quality) third-person model slightly differs, though, probably showing a Type 56. Opinions? --Ultimate94ninja (talk) 17:58, 17 October 2017 (EDT)
I've made the change to list it as an M70B1 for now (EDIT: it has a Type 56 hooded front sight; I'm gonna mention this on the page, though most parts of the weapon match the Zastava, including the gas block), and since there isn't much detail on the front sight of the third-person model, I think we can safely list the latter as an actual AK-47. --Ultimate94ninja (talk) 07:08, 20 October 2017 (EDT)
